Artificial Intelligence for Governance and Sustainable Development

The KAUST Academy AI course stands as the centerpiece of the catalog, offering two distinct tracks designed for different professional profiles. Track 1, “AI for Leaders,” targets senior executives, government officials, and decision-makers who need strategic understanding of artificial intelligence without deep technical implementation knowledge. This five-day program covers the full spectrum of AI governance, from foundational concepts to real-world case studies of organizations that have successfully integrated AI into their operations.

Day one introduces participants to the broad landscape of artificial intelligence, including machine learning, deep learning, and natural language processing, with emphasis on cross-domain applications. The second day dives into AI ethics and governance—examining bias, transparency, accountability, and established frameworks for responsible AI deployment. This ethical dimension is particularly critical for government leaders who must balance innovation with public trust and regulatory compliance.

The strategic core of the leadership track occupies days three through five. Participants learn to develop AI strategies for their organizations, identify and prioritize use cases, build AI teams, and manage transformation initiatives. The program culminates with an exploration of AI’s impact on the future of work and the specific role leaders play in driving ethical adoption. Case studies drawn from healthcare, finance, manufacturing, and government agencies provide concrete models for implementation.

The target audience includes leaders from government agencies and nonprofit organizations, executives across industries including finance and healthcare, service managers incorporating AI into operations, and public servants shaping AI regulations. AI Professional Track: Hands-On Machine Learning Training

Track 2 of the KAUST Academy AI course caters to early-career professionals working in government and development sectors who engage directly with data and digital technology. Unlike the leadership track, this pathway requires participants to roll up their sleeves and write code. While the course is self-contained, KAUST recommends basic familiarity with linear algebra, calculus, and programming as prerequisites—reflecting the technical depth of the curriculum.

The professional track follows a progressive five-day structure. Day one mirrors the leadership track’s introduction to AI concepts, ensuring all participants share a common vocabulary. Day two transitions into machine learning fundamentals, covering supervised and unsupervised learning, classification, regression, and clustering. Participants engage in hands-on exercises using state-of-the-art machine learning libraries and tools, building practical skills they can immediately apply in their roles.

Day three escalates to advanced techniques including deep learning with neural networks, convolutional neural networks (CNNs), and recurrent neural networks (RNNs). Natural language processing—text analysis, language translation, and voice recognition—rounds out the technical curriculum. Participants complete hands-on projects that demonstrate real-world applications of these technologies. The fourth day addresses AI ethics and governance from a practitioner’s perspective, while day five explores emerging trends and the role of professionals in shaping AI’s future.

What truly differentiates this track is its learning outcome: participants graduate with the ability to implement and deploy machine learning algorithms on AWS and Google Cloud platforms. This cloud deployment capability transforms theoretical knowledge into production-ready skills, preparing professionals to build AI solutions that serve government agencies and development organizations at scale.

Introduction to Data Science and Machine Learning

KAUST Academy’s second core offering addresses the growing demand for data science expertise across Saudi Arabia’s public and private sectors. This micro-credential course provides participants with a comprehensive overview of data science and machine learning, equipping them with practical tools to extract value from organizational data. The curriculum focuses on building capacity in core data science methods while enabling learners to develop their own applications.

The five-day program follows a carefully scaffolded progression. Day one establishes foundations: the definition and history of data science, key concepts in data acquisition, cleaning, and exploration, plus real-world applications across industries. Day two focuses on data visualization and exploration techniques—charts, graphs, maps, and strategies for identifying patterns and trends. Case studies demonstrate best practices for communicating data insights to stakeholders.

The machine learning component spans days three through five. Participants first encounter core ML concepts including supervised and unsupervised learning, then progress to advanced techniques such as deep learning with neural networks and natural language processing. The final day examines real-world machine learning applications, discusses ethical implications, and explores the technology’s societal impact. Throughout, hands-on exercises using current libraries and tools ensure participants build portfolio-ready skills.

Cybersecurity Fundamentals for Enterprise Protection

As Saudi Arabia accelerates its digital transformation, cybersecurity has become a national priority. KAUST Academy’s Cybersecurity Fundamentals course provides technical and managerial concepts essential for protecting enterprise infrastructure. The curriculum covers foundational principles that every technology professional should understand, from network security architectures to incident response planning.

The course opens with core security principles: Least Privilege, Need to Know, and the Confidentiality-Integrity-Availability (CIA) triad that drives all security decisions. Participants learn risk management fundamentals, security policy development, and the Authentication-Authorization-Accountability (AAA) framework. Technical foundations include numbering schemes, computer and network architectures, and communications protocols—LAN, WAN, MAN, OSI, TCP/IP, UDP, DNS, ICMP, DHCP, and NAT.

Days two and three focus on risk management and policy development. Participants learn to identify and assess cybersecurity risks, develop risk management plans, and build policies that ensure compliance with international standards and frameworks. Days four and five address the human element—awareness training programs, security culture development—and conclude with incident response planning. Participants develop comprehensive incident response playbooks and analyze real-world breach case studies.

This course is particularly relevant for professionals in Saudi Arabia’s financial sector, critical infrastructure, and government agencies. The National Cybersecurity Authority (NCA) has established stringent frameworks that organizations must follow, and KAUST Academy’s program provides the foundational knowledge needed to implement and maintain compliance.

Internet of Things: Sensor Programming and Cloud Platforms

The Internet of Things course represents KAUST Academy’s most hands-on offering, combining hardware programming with cloud platform integration. This micro-credential takes participants from sensor fundamentals through data acquisition, processing with TinyML on edge nodes, network connectivity, and cloud-based application development. The practical, project-driven approach ensures participants leave with working IoT prototypes.

The five-day curriculum starts with IoT fundamentals and progresses through sensor and actuator theory, IoT protocols (MQTT, CoAP, HTTP), and cloud platform deployment. Participants program real sensor modules, acquire data streams, process information using TinyML frameworks on edge devices, and connect everything through networked architectures. The culminating project involves building a complete IoT application from sensor to cloud dashboard.
